Bring in EDK2 routines for printing and parsing device paths.

Bring in EDK2 routines for printing and parsing device paths.
This commit implements the (mostly?) Linux compatible efidp_format_device_path and efidp_parse_device_path APIs. These are the only APIs exposed through this library. However, they are built on code from Tianocore's EDK2 MdePkg. They are brought in as new files here for reasons described in FreeBSD-update.
Symbol versioning will be introduced to control what's exported from the EDK2 code.
Some structural changes may be necessary when we move to sharing with sys/boot/efi.
